No security measures are currently in place for this chat service.

At this stage, you are going to upgrade this service in terms of security.

Typically, the first step in a secure communication protocol for both parties is to authenticate each other and negotiate a common secret key.

In this exercise, the goal is not to implement authentication, and now just assume that the two parties have authenticated each other and established a common secret key.

To simulate a shared secret key, you must call the getValue.InsecureSharedValue () function.

See the java.InsecureSharedValue file. This value is read from the config file and we assume that this is a hidden value that only the client and the server know about.

So the confidentiality and integrity of the message in this exercise is our goal. To do this, the data exchanged in this system must be encrypted in the transmitter and decrypted in the receiver. So the purpose of a connection is encrypted.

Your code must eventually win the attack with the following assumptions:

% The enemy knows your encryption algorithm. That is, when it sniffs and receives encrypted text, the decryption algorithm knows it.

% The enemy can see all the network traffic.

*%*The enemy can generate fake network traffic.

*%*The enemy does not have the value getValue.InsecureSharedValue()

If the enemy fails to do the following, you win :)

  • Create a fake chat message and send it on behalf of a user.

  • Understand the content of the chat message.
